Marsh, Root headline SA20 marquee signings; Du Plessis exits JSK
Representative image ยท Pexels (free license)
Key points

The SA20 league has added two of cricket's most sought-after white-ball names to its roster for the upcoming season. Mitchell Marsh and Joe Root, both established internationals, have been confirmed among the marquee signings, giving the tournament a significant boost in star power.

While the specific franchise assignments for Marsh and Root have not been officially announced, their inclusion underscores the league's growing appeal. The two players bring contrasting strengths โ€” Marsh with his explosive all-round ability and Root with his classical technique and experience across formats.

Du Plessis' departure from JSK

In a separate development, Faf du Plessis has been released by the Joburg Super Kings. The former South Africa captain was one of the franchise's most recognisable faces, and his exit marks a notable change in the team's core group.

Du Plessis has been a marquee figure in franchise cricket globally, and his release from JSK is likely to spark interest from other SA20 teams. Neither the franchise nor the player has commented on the reasons behind the decision, though such moves are common as teams rebuild their squads ahead of the auction.
